What is a remote audition reader?

A Remote Audition Reader is a person who assists actors during virtual auditions by reading lines for other characters in the script. They help create a more natural and interactive audition experience by providing cues and context for the performer. This role is typically done via video conferencing platforms and is essential for both casting directors and actors during remote or self-taped audition processes.

What are the typical daily responsibilities of a remote audition reader, and how do they collaborate with casting teams?

As a Remote Audition Reader, your main responsibility is to read scripts with actors during virtual audition sessions, providing consistent scene partners and helping create a comfortable environment for talent. You’ll closely collaborate with casting directors and coordinators by following specific scene directions, adjusting your performance based on feedback, and maintaining confidentiality about projects. Communication is key, as you'll often coordinate schedules and technical setups with the team, ensuring smooth and efficient sessions. This role can be fast-paced, requiring adaptability and professionalism, especially when working with a variety of actors and industry professionals remotely.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ote audition reader,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Audition Reader, you need a thorough understanding of acting techniques, script analysis, and familiarity with the audition process, often supported by experience in theater, film, or casting. Comfort with video conferencing platforms, audition management software, and high-quality recording equipment is essential. Excellent communication, adaptability, and the ability to provide constructive feedback are vital soft skills for fostering a supportive audition environment. These skills ensure that actors are evaluated fairly and efficiently and that the casting process runs smoothly in a virtual setting.
